Flickering Lights Concerns
When homeowners witness flickering lights, it often demonstrates underlying electrical issues that require qualified intervention. This circumstance can originate in varied causes, featuring loose connections, faulty wiring, or inadequate power supply. While infrequent flickering may appear insightful guide minor, sustained issues can generate significant dangers, such as electrical fires or system malfunction. Homeowners should not neglect these cautionary signs, as they can demonstrate severe systemic issues across the home's power system. Reliable electrical professionals are important for determining the root problem and delivering safe and effective solutions. Prompt professional action by qualified experts can validate the reliability and protection of a residence's electrical setup, in the long run defending both the property and occupants from potential dangers.
Circuit Breaker Defects
Circuit breaker complications are among the most widespread electrical complications homeowners encounter, often suggesting underlying problems within the electrical system. These difficulties appear as tripped breakers, which can occur due to overloaded circuits, short circuits, or ground faults. Repeated activation can also point to aging or faulty breakers that need immediate care. Disregarding these indicators may cause more serious electrical dangers, including fire risks. Homeowners should never attempt to fix circuit breaker problems themselves, as improper handling can worsen the situation. Trusted electrical services provide the expertise needed to identify and fix these issues securely. By addressing circuit breaker issues promptly, homeowners can ensure the safety and reliability of their electrical systems, protecting both their property and loved ones.

When should you contact Emergency Electrical Services?
When should homeowners consider calling for emergency electrical services? There are several critical situations that call for immediate professional attention. First, frequent circuit breaker tripping may indicate an overloaded system or faulty wiring, posing fire risks. Second, any signs of shock sensations or outlets that spark should not be ignored, as these can lead to critical dangers. Additionally, areas without power that affect only specific areas of a home may suggest more serious electrical problems. Householders should also seek emergency services if they detect unusual burning smells, which could signal excess heat buildup or electrical fires. Finally, damaged power lines or downed wires from storms demand professional intervention to guarantee safety. In these scenarios, timely action can prevent injuries and extensive property damage, reinforcing the importance of knowing when to seek emergency help.
Contemporary Power Alternatives for Regular Needs
As technology keeps progressing, homeowners increasingly rely on modern electrical solutions to improve comfort, security, and power conservation in their daily lives. Intelligent household networks have grown increasingly common, enabling users to manage lights, climate control, and protective systems from a distance through mobile devices or voice-controlled technology. These systems not only streamline household management but also contribute to energy savings by improving consumption habits.
LED lighting has also emerged as a popular option, delivering brilliant light while using significantly less energy than conventional bulbs. Furthermore, renewable solar systems are gaining traction, allowing homeowners to utilize renewable energy, reduce utility bills, and lessen their environmental impact.
Moreover, power monitoring systems offer real-time monitoring, helping families track their consumption and identify areas for improvement. Together, these contemporary power systems provide a comprehensive approach to managing household power requirements while promoting a safer and increasingly efficient living environment.

Comprehending Electrical Codes
Knowing electrical codes is essential for securing safety and compliance in any electrical installation. These codes, compiled by national and local authorities, provide instructions that assure both functionality and safety. Observing these standards limits the risk of electrical hazards, such as shocks or fires, by prescribing correct wiring practices, grounding methods, and circuit protection. Each jurisdiction may have specific requirements, making it important for electricians to remain informed about regional codes. Failure to comply can bring penalties, project delays, and jeopardized safety. By emphasizing understanding and compliance with electrical codes, property owners and professionals foster a safer environment, ensuring installations satisfy the necessary legal and safety standards. How Can I Boost Power Conservation at Home?
To increase energy efficiency at home, one can set up energy-efficient appliances, use LED lighting, seal windows and doors, add adequate insulation, utilize programmable thermostats, and implement smart power strips to minimize energy waste efficiently.
